Course Content

• The Science of Forgiveness: Neuroscience, Psychology, and the Biology of Letting Go
• Cultivating Emotional Resilience: Strategies for Building Inner Strength and Coping Mechanisms
• Understanding Trauma and its Impact on Forgiveness: Pathways to Healing and Recovery
• Forgiveness and Interpersonal Relationships: Repairing Damaged Bonds and Restoring Trust
• Self-Compassion and Self-Forgiveness: A Foundation for Emotional Well-being
• Mindfulness and Meditation for Emotional Regulation: Techniques for Reducing Stress and Anxiety
• The Role of Empathy and Compassion in the Forgiveness Process
• Forgiveness in Different Cultural Contexts: Exploring Diverse Perspectives and Practices
• Forgiveness and Spiritual Practices: Integrating Faith and Belief Systems
